(Photo by Gabe Ginsberg/WireImage) WireImageThe Walt Disney Co. unveiled long-awaited details about its Disney+ streaming service Thursday in an elaborate presentation on the studio’s Burbank lot, announcing an aggressive strategy that undercuts rivals on price even as it bulks up on some of the world's most recognizable entertainment brands. Star Wars storm troopers greeting analysts and press as they arrived for the investor presentation. Disney+ will cost $6.99 a month when it debuts on Nov. 12 — less than Netflix’s cheapest plan, at $8.99 a month. “We feel Disney is loved by so many millions and millions of people around the world,” said Iger.
